strrchr
strrchr
(PHP 4, PHP 5, PHP 7)
strrchr — Find the last occurrence of a character in a string
Description
string strrchr ( string $haystack , mixed $needle )
This function returns the portion of haystack
which starts at the last occurrence of needle
and goes until the end of haystack
.
Parameters
-
haystack
-
The string to search in
-
needle
-
If
needle
contains more than one character, only the first is used. This behavior is different from that of strstr().If
needle
is not a string, it is converted to an integer and applied as the ordinal value of a character.
Return Values
This function returns the portion of string, or FALSE
if needle
is not found.
Changelog
Version | Description |
---|---|
4.3.0 | This function is now binary safe. |
Examples
Example #1 strrchr() example
<?php // get last directory in $PATH $dir = substr(strrchr($PATH, ":"), 1); // get everything after last newline $text = "Line 1\nLine 2\nLine 3"; $last = substr(strrchr($text, 10), 1 ); ?>
Notes
Note: This function is binary-safe.
See Also
© 1997–2017 The PHP Documentation Group
Licensed under the Creative Commons Attribution License v3.0 or later.
https://secure.php.net/manual/en/function.strrchr.php